Ideal for 2 to 4 people, our recently restored, tastefully decorated, 2 bedroomed vacation cottage and swimming pool is situated in a small hamlet in the depths of the French countryside about 10 minutes drive from the pretty town of St.Antonin-Noble-Val - 82140 and the beautiful little village of Penne du Tarn - 81140. Cordes-sur-Ciel is about 20 minutes drive.

INSIDE THE COTTAGE:

Downstairs is an open plan kitchen, dining area and living room, light and airy with the three French windows giving access to the swimming pool, the front courtyard and the ‘inside/outside’ room. The whole house is very well insulated and for those cooler days in spring and autumn, there is a cosy wood burning stove downstairs that keeps the whole house beautifully warm!

Upstairs are two bedrooms and one bathroom. Bedroom 1 has 2 single beds (which could be pushed together for an extra large double). Bedroom 2 has a large double bed and French windows that open onto the large upstairs balcony which overlooks the garden and swimming pool areas (great for star gazing at night). I decided on a white and black décor for the bedrooms - light, modern and fun to sleep in!

OUTSIDE AREAS:

The pool, the sun deck, the outdoor 'rooms' - for swimming, relaxing , reading, barbecue, eating, playing - or whatever - YOU ARE ON HOLIDAY!

The swimming pool is 4m x 8m with wide shallow Roman steps which are ideal for young children and less sporty types who feel toe dipping is enough and sun worshipping on one of the chic black loungers is more to their liking. Yes, the sun deck is expansive and the parasols are on wheels, so you can move around and follow the sun or find some shade.

Between the house and the pool is the rear terrace with dining table, chairs and barbecue for al fresco eating and comfortable outdoor chairs for reading and relaxing.

On the other side of the cottage is the walled front courtyard. A very pleasant area to sit and relax.

From the courtyard you can go though the big wooden red doors and explore the HAMLET of FABRE DE LAGRANGE. Go and say bonjour to the chickens across the path, walk to the end of the hamlet and perhaps take a walk along the marked pathway which can take you to the village of PENNE if you feel up to it, otherwise just take a stroll to take in the magnificent views over the Forest of the Gresigne and the Château de Penne.

The cottage is situated at the far end of our large main house, so is semi-detached with your own private entrance.
